Lovers of variegated plants will enjoy this unusual xanthosoma. Its dark green leaves have differing variegations that first appear yellow and later fade to white. As they mature, they curl slightly and resemble Mickey Mouse's head in shape, earning them the nickname of Disney's most famous rodent. With good care and adequate space, it can grow up to one and a half meters.

Ben's tips on plant care:
- Location/Light Requirements: partial shade to light, avoid direct sunlight.
- Substrate: Ben's Babyplant Soil, Special Soil, later Ben's Philodendron & Monstera Soil, Special Soil
- Temperature: optimal at 18-24° C, do not let cool down below 15° C
- Watering: at least. Water well 1x per week, keep substrate moist but avoid waterlogging. Water rarely in winter.
- Humidity: Requires high humidity.
- Nutrient addition: In spring/summer about every 2 weeks with liquid fertilizer.
- As a bulb plant, requires winter dormancy and should then be watered only rarely.
